KELTNER, Rebecca Sue

-

Age 53, of Fairfield, passed away on November 1, 2021, due to complicati­ons from

COVID-19 pneumonia. She was born on September 28, 1968, in

Hamilton, Ohio, the daughter of Frank and Jacquelyn House.

Becky graduated from Fairfield

High School in 1986. She married Rick Keltner (FHS’76) on March 18, 1995. Becky was an exceptiona­l athlete during her youth participat­ing in softball, volleyball, basketball, and bowling. From hours at the Civitan Club to the YMCA to Fairfield Lanes, she had a love of sport and was the ideal teammate. These friendship­s carried her through life. As an adult, Becky found true passion in genealogy and preserving family memories. She took pleasure in helping others appreciate photograph­s through scrapbooki­ng events in her home and at local hotels. Becky spent hours tracking down family stories and connecting with cousins across the country. Becky also delighted in collecting vintage toys and housewares especially those from her own childhood. She found a special joy in Fisher-Price and Pyrex. Becky was preceded in death by her mother Jacquelyn House; maternal grandmothe­r Edna Grant; as well as other grandparen­ts, aunts, uncles, family, and friends. She is survived by her father Frank House; husband Rick Keltner; two daughters Kylie Keltner, and Andrea (Nick) Taylor; two grandsons Oliver and Ziggy. Becky is loved by many aunts, uncles, cousins, and other family who will carry her memory with them always. Visitation will be on Monday, November 8, 2021, at THE WEBSTER FUNERAL HOME, 3080 Homeward Way at Rt. 4, Fairfield from 11:00AM until the time of the funeral at 1:00PM with Pastor Tim White officiatin­g. Burial to follow in Rose Hill Burial Park. www.websterfun­eralhomes.com.
